The first game of the FIFA Club World Cup sees Egyptian side Al Ahly take on Lionel Messi's Inter Miami side. For both of these sides, this will be an excellent opportunity to kickstart the tournament with a victory, knowing that either FC Porto or Palmeiras are likely to qualify from this group.
Al Ahly are coming into this game with six consecutive victories in competitive matches. Despite the level of opposition, they have shown great potency in the attacking area, having scored first in six of their previous eight games in all competitions. Al Ahly's chances will be resting on the talents of Emam Ashour, who last season provided 20 goal contributions for the Egyptian side.
The Red Devils are likely to be one of the weaker sides in the competition and will be expected to struggle against a physically more imposing Inter Miami side.
Inter Miami's side is packed with players who are vastly experienced in this competition, with the likes of Sergio Busquets and Luis Suarez having played in this competition for Barcelona. Inter Miami are unbeaten in their last three games, and they have shown their ruthless intensity by scoring at least three goals in their previous three matches.
This game should provide goals, as Inter Miami have not kept a clean sheet in their last 10 matches. Over 2.5 goals have been scored in five of the last seven games involving Al Ahly and in the previous nine games involving Inter Miami.
Inter Miami's squad and quality in depth should see them over the line against an Al Ahly side who are expected to make an early exit from this competition.
